धरामवष्टभ्य करद्वयेन तत्कूर्परस्थापितनाभिपार्श्वः । उच्चासनो दण्डवद् उत्थितः खे मायूरम् एतत् प्रवदन्ति पीठम् ॥३२॥ Listen to the recitation of the thirty-second verse first chapter of the Hatha Yoga Pradipika and recite these Hatha Yoga Pradipika Shlokas before practising any Hatha Yoga: dharam avashtabhya kara dvayena tat kurpara sthapita nabhi parshvah | uchchasano danda vad utthitah khe mayuram etat pravadanti pitham ||32|| If you want to recite along or just read the Sanskrit text (Devanagari and Roman Script), just go to Hatha Yoga Pradipika I 32 Hatha Yoga Pradipika is the most important classical text on the theory and practice of Hatha Yoga.
